Skip to content

集成一些传入bot变量的方式 #8

@liuzixiao666

Description

@liuzixiao666

⚠️ 搜索是否存在类似issue

  • 我已经搜索过issues和disscussions,没有发现相似issue

总结

dify的api调用时,是支持传入变量的,变量在构建聊天机器人中十分重要
但是我们的dify on wechat在这块只能默认传入query
input内居然是纯空的,绷不住了哈哈哈
以下为源码
def _get_payload(self, query, session: DifySession, response_mode): return { 'inputs': {}, "query": query, "response_mode": response_mode, "conversation_id": session.get_conversation_id(), "user": session.get_user() }
期望能有入口传入input参数
当前我处理的方式是在context改为json形式,然后修改_get_payload的input和query取值逻辑实现的
不过我还是希望官方能有办法hh

举例

No response

动机

No response

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ions